Solid-State Hard Drives
It is one of the non-volatile storage options for the media on your laptop or PC system. Moreover, it comprises the two major components that differentiate it from traditional drive options. The two significant components are;
- Flash Controller
- Flash Memory Chips NAND
On the other beneficial points, the SSD is a smaller option in terms of size and range. Despite its smaller size, it still promotes boot working. Due to its advantages, it is getting very popular for laptop and PC systems.

How to Install SSD on PC?
To be familiar with How to Install SSD? We might be cautious regarding its plugging, unplugging, and all the other related activities. You might be clear about some of the mechanical expertise.
Here we will state a user-friendly installation guide that can help you to seek professional performance from SSD.
- Firstly, get into the internal hardware portion of the computer. For this, you have to separate the tower case. Unscrew the sides very carefully and finely to expose all the inner areas by removing the sides of the case. You have to get access to the motherboard’s SATA port and the hard-drive display.
- There you will see a mounting bracket. Insert your chosen SSD at the place. The frame should line up with the underneath holes for the proper screwing of the drive at that place.
- Now, take a SATA cable. Connect one side with the SSD and the other with the motherboard’s SATA port. This will power up the system with the help of the SATA power cable system.
